Navigating the complexities of property law often involves a grasp of key concepts like liens and conveyances. A lien, in essence, is a legal charge on a property, serving as security for an outstanding debt or obligation. Common types of liens include mechanic's liens, tax liens, and judgment liens. Conversely, a conveyance refers to the transmission of ownership rights in real estate from one party to another. This legal transaction is typically documented through a deed, outlining the terms and conditions of the property disposition. Understanding these concepts is essential for both buyers and sellers to ensure a smooth and lawful real estate transaction.
Estate Planning: Wills, Trusts & Probate Guidance
Planning for the future demands making sound decisions about your assets and estate. Sound estate plan can help guarantee that your wishes are carried out after your passing. A well-crafted will is often the basis of an estate plan, specifying how your property shall pass. Trusts, on the other hand, offer more control in managing assets and potentially reducing estate taxes. Navigating the probate process can present challenges. Seeking guidance from an experienced estate planning attorney can provide you with the expertise needed to create a plan that meets your specific needs.
Keep in mind that estate plans are not static. Revising your plan periodically is essential to reflect changes in your life and situation.
